About this chess game
This chess game between John Bick (2201) and Dean Ippolito (2417) was played at FKB ch-USA Qualifier in 2008 and finished 0–1. The opening was the Nimzo-Indian Defense: St. Petersburg Variation, Fischer Variation (E45).
